Just 9 miles away is Crescent City, where you’ll find tide pools, sea stacks, lighthouses, and oceanfront dining. We are a 30 minute drive from the quaint coastal town of Brookings, Oregon and easily accessed from California Redwood Coast–Humboldt County Airport (ACV), also commonly known as the Arcata–Eureka Airport (a 90 minute gorgeous coastal drive) or the Rogue Valley International Airport in Medford, also an easy and scenic drive. Prefer to fly in closer? Del Norte County Regional Airport offers direct flights into Crescent City via Advanced Air.

Renowned for its towering trees, some reaching heights of 300 feet, the grove offers visitors an intimate experience with these ancient giants. The minimal undergrowth and the sheer scale of the redwoods create a cathedral-like ambiance, making it a favorite among photographers and nature enthusiasts.
Hikers wind through a cathedral of towering redwoods, past carpets of lush ferns and quiet, meandering streams on this moderately challenging trail. A standout moment comes at the Boy Scout Tree—a colossal, double-trunked giant named by a local scoutmaster. The journey ends at Fern Falls, a gentle cascade tucked deep in the forest, offering a serene spot to pause before heading back.
